The state and NH Food Bank are offering help during the shutdown. Here’s how to find that help.
The state has partnered with the New Hampshire Food Bank to set up a fleet of state-funded mobile food pantries, just for SNAP recipients. (Photo by Spencer Platt/Getty Images)On Saturday, people enrolled in the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program — the nation’s food assistance program — didn’t receive the benefits they were scheduled to receive amid what could soon become the longest federal government shutdown in history.
